All are thought about laboratory-developed tests, and are for that reason not regulated by the Food and Drug Administration. ad Yet doctor groups have actually for years advised versus utilizing immunoglobulin G tests to examine for so-called food level of sensitivities or intolerances. And allergy experts informed STAT that the test is useless at best and could even cause harm if it leads consumers to unnecessarily cut healthy foods from their diet plan.

Food level of sensitivity is an umbrella term that includes signs that can develop, for example, from problem absorbing a food, as in lactose intolerance, or susceptibility to the result of a food, as in caffeine sensitivity. These symptoms, nevertheless, do not include an immune action. Dr. Martha Hartz, an allergist at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minn., states she often assesses patients who have actually currently handed over the money for the screening. "Anytime I see a client who's had these sort of tests, we get them to toss it aside," Hartz said.

It is just not a test that needs to done." Everly, Well's food sensitivity test uses a blood sample to search for body immune system activity. Everly, Well's food sensitivity tests exploit an aggravating fact for those questioning whether their signs originate from the food they consume: There is no easy method to find an answer. The doctor-advised technique is to cut common culprits from the diet plan one by one a so-called elimination diet however that is cumbersome, lengthy, and, by its very nature, limiting.

What's truly interesting about food level of sensitivities is that symptoms generally do not look like quickly as you eat the problem food. Rather, you might have symptoms hours or days after consuming that food which can make it tough to link specific foods to the signs you're experiencing. Nevertheless, as the certified diet professional Tamara Duker Freuman composed in a piece for Self, a professional would rather you not take a test before seeing them. That's because they have to resolve any concepts that the test had given the patient. The best case scenarios are those in which the client listens.

'Shark Tank'-funded Food Sensitivity Test Is Medically ...

Worst case situations include clients who bought into the outcomes of food sensitivity tests totally - everlywell community. "I have actually enjoyed helplessly as my client vanishes down a rabbit hole of food constraint and avoidance that can, for some individuals, lead to disordered consuming," Freuman shared, describing how clients assume they just need to get rid of more food from their diet plan.
